I can remember being very uninspired when last years poster came out and even had the briefest of thoughts about not going. Wasn’t keen at all on any of the 3 headliners, and for my first time going I thought this would be disastrous. You all know ( and I do now) that this is not the case at all. I ended up having the best time ever and now find myself not really wanting to have more than one pyramid headliner as it gives you a better experience exploring the other stages.
Given my feelings about last years poster and how good a time I ended up having, I can’t even begin to imagine how good this year is going to be!

Carly Rae Jepsen. First night of tour. Dublin Saturday night.
One of the most fun nights I have had in many years. Electric atmosphere right from the start, great crowd and she rattled through 26 songs in around 1hr 40. I have never seen her live before but went with high expectations and she still managed to exceed them.Would love to see her booked for the farm this year - she would be perfect for the JP tent.
